Evelyn Sharma expecting her second child

| @indiablooms | Jan 17, 2023, at 11:22 pm

Mumbai: Actress Evelyn Sharma, who featured in Ranbir Kapoor 2013 release Yeh Jawaani Hai Deewani, on Tuesday announced she is expecting her second child.

Sharing pictures of her baby bump, Evelyn wrote on Instagram: "Can’t wait to hold you in my arms!! Baby #2 is on the way!"

She is married to Tushaan Bhindi.

In the comment section many Bollywood celebrities congratulated her as she is now gearing up to welcome another member in the family.

"Many congratulations twice the love and fun," Neha Dhupia wrote.

Actress Lisa Haydon said: "Congrats Evelyn. Beautiful news."

Actor Neil Nitin Mukesh wrote: "Congratulations to you my dearest such great news."

Evelyn had welcomed her first child-daughter Ava- in 2021.

Evelyn worked in several Bollywood movies like From Sydney With Love, Nautanki Saala, Issaq, Main Tera Hero and Yaariyan.
